When is the cheapest time to rent a car?
The best time to rent a car at a lower price is during off-peak seasons or weekdays (Monday–Thursday). Booking at least a few weeks in advance also helps secure better rates.
How can I avoid extra fees on my rental car?
Read the rental agreement carefully to avoid hidden fees. Opt for full-to-full fuel policies, avoid airport rentals if possible, and return the car on time to avoid late charges.
Can I save money by renting a car from an off-airport location?
Yes, renting from off-airport locations can often be cheaper, as airport rentals may include additional fees and higher base rates.
Is it cheaper to rent a car at the airport or off-site?
Renting a car from an off-airport location is usually cheaper since airport rentals often have extra fees and higher demand. Using public transport or a taxi to reach a nearby rental office can save you money.
